## Configuration

Canary gating for Driftgate releases is controlled in `.env.canary`. Set `CANARY_ERROR_BUDGET=0.5` and `CANARY_MIN_BAKE_MINUTES=30`. Promotion is blocked if error rate exceeds budget during bake. Rollback is automatic; do not override `CANARY_FORCE_PROMOTE` without sign-off from the Larkfield release channel. Gate evaluation runs on the Pellman metrics cluster, so metrics lag of up to two minutes is expected. The gate service also authenticates to the metrics API, so add its token on the next line.

env line for fafof-fahag: LEDGER_TOKEN5=f8790

Subject: Snapshot testing cut-over — done!

Hi all, quick recap for the sync: we finished moving the Lanternfield component library off the old pixel-diff rig and onto Snapgrove snapshot tests. All 412 components migrated; eleven needed baseline regeneration because of font rendering drift. CI time dropped about six minutes per run, which is a nice bonus. Flaky animation components are quarantined behind a tag until Priya's stabilization pass lands next sprint. For anyone reproducing locally, the runner expects the following configuration.

settings of yageg-yahap:
[gorael]
team = olieth
access_code = ac_941d74
owner = brieth.aldiel
host = gorael.tolvaqio.internal
port = 6379
peer = briwyn.urlaqtech.internal
salt = 116e6622
pin = 1957

Welcome aboard. Grapheon is our dependency graph visualizer; it crawls the Larkspur monorepo nightly and renders module relationships for the architecture reviews. Before running it locally, install the pinned toolchain from `tools/versions.lock` and confirm the render cache directory exists. Grapheon authenticates to the internal package index to resolve private modules, and that requires one credential in your .env file, entered as follows:

sealed setting: LEDGER_TOKEN13=5d842615a26d7